Dimensions

Length: 5.14 m4.55 m
Width: 1.95 m1.77 m
Height: 1.46 m1.43 m
Audi A8 is larger.
Audi A8 is 59 cm longer than the Audi A4, 18 cm wider, while the height of Audi A8 is 3 cm higher.
Trunk capacity: 510 litres445 litres
Trunk max capacity:
with rear seats folded down
1142 litresno data
Audi A8 has more luggage capacity.
Audi A8 has 65 litres more trunk space than the Audi A4.
Turning diameter: 12.3 meters11.1 meters
The turning circle of the Audi A8 is 1.2 metres more than that of the Audi A4, which means Audi A8 can be harder to manoeuvre in tight streets and parking spaces.
